引用本文:安建峰,游红俊,赵伟勋,刘咪咪,张盛兵.星载异构计算环境下的能耗优化任务调度[J].上海航天,2021,38(4):38-44.
【打印本页】   【下载PDF全文】     
本文已被:浏览 445次   下载 393
分享到: 微信 更多
星载异构计算环境下的能耗优化任务调度
安建峰1,游红俊2,赵伟勋1,刘咪咪1,张盛兵1
1.西北工业大学 计算机学院,陕西 西安710129;2.上海航天电子技术研究所,上海201109
摘要:
针对航空航天探测等要求高可靠性、强实时性、低功耗的尖端领域,基于新型的异构多核计算平台对全迁移策略的支持,提出了能耗优化的实时任务调度算法。算法主要分为2部分:负载分配和任务调度。负载分配确定每个任务在不同的处理器集群上工作量的分配比例,并对系统的能耗进行优化。任务调度在负载分配的基础上,采用时间片划分的思想对已分配的任务进行合理调度,保证每个任务都能满足系统约束条件。将此算法与现有的SA算法和Hetero-Split算法进行对比,实验结果显示:此算法比Hetero-Split算法在寻求可行性任务调度方案方面相当,但强于SA算法;在能耗比方面,此算法比Hetero-Split算法在系统总能耗方面有大幅度的降低,降低比率约为23%~24%。
(1.School of Computer Science, Northwestern Polytechnic University, Xi’an 710129, Shaanxi, China;2.Shanghai Aerospace Electronic Technology Institute, Shanghai 201109, China)

分享按钮